What is the Florida Court Records Request Form?

The Florida Court Records Request Form is essential for acquiring court records from the Orange County Clerk's Records Management Division. This form serves as a gateway for individuals seeking public court records, highlighting the importance of transparency in legal processes. Accessing these records allows users to obtain critical information for personal or professional use.

Field-by-Field Instructions

Each field in the Florida Court Records Request Form serves a specific purpose:
  • Case Information: Enter pertinent details such as the case party name and case number.
  • Requester Details: Provide your full name, address, and contact information.
  • Document Type Requested: Specify the type of court document you need, ensuring clarity.
Be cautious of common mistakes, such as missing information or incorrect case numbers, which can delay processing.

Fees, Deadlines, and Processing Time

When submitting your request, be aware of potential fees associated with obtaining the records. Costs can vary based on the type of document requested. Typically, processing times can range from a few days to several weeks, depending on the volume of requests received and the specific nature of the request.
